    Default Which Fabric for Portraits on Spoonflower

    I'm doing a memory quilt for my niece, which will have over 35 photos on it! I've always used the petal cotton for my quilted wall hangings but it appears too thin for my photos as you may see through it.

    Which fabrics on Spoonflower do you recommend for Photos and why? Thank you, yolajean

    I used the petal signature cotton for the three that I made for a memory quilt. They turned out perfect and VERY true to color.
    I did not have a problem with see-through.

    I’ve used the petal signature cotton and the cotton sateen- both turned out great. The cotton sateen has a shimmer to it, a it’s a little different but beautiful.
